Propeller fits motor shafts with 3.2 mm diameter, diameter of cone is 38 mm. Distance between blade attachment points is approx. 39 mm. Center bore for 6 mm collet adapter
Propeller blades with 6 mm width at root do not fit to hub which is machined for 8 mm blades, it is necessary to add 1 mm distance washers to prevent movement of blades.
Nice workmanship of aluminum parts. 4 stars rating for non fitting blades

Bought this to go on my Ascent Eflight sailplane. I use a graupner 4:1 inline gearbox on a Turnigy 2040 4850 Kv in-runner on 2S 20C 1300mah Zippy flightmax cells using a Hobby King 18 amp ESC and Hobby King 6C 2.4 radio. The climb out is outrageous!!! 30 sec is a max as it is a spec in the sky. Spinner and prop are nicely balanced and run true. Fold is immediate and fits nicely around the Nose. Static current is 24 amps @ 6400 rpm!!!
